ABOUT OUR AGENCY:
I’ve been a State Farm agent since July 2000 and lead a close-knit team that includes three full-time licensed agents, along with my wife, who is also fully licensed and works part-time in the agency. I’ve lived in this area most of my life and earned my degree in finance from the University of Dayton, which helps guide the thoughtful, detail-oriented approach we take with our customers. Our office is highly customer-focused, with integrity and accuracy at the center of everything we do. Giving back matters to us as well — we volunteer as a team at least once per quarter and participate in community events throughout the year.
We take pride in investing in our team by offering a matching retirement plan, life and disability insurance, contributing up to 50% of health insurance premiums, commissions and bonus opportunities, logoed apparel, and paid training both in-house and through outside providers. We also celebrate our team through monthly meals, recognition, birthdays, work anniversaries, and increasing PTO each year. I care deeply about my team and want them to enjoy coming to work every day, and for the right person, this is a place where you’ll feel supported, valued, and part of something that truly lasts.
